Types of Proofreading Tools

There’s a wide range of proofreading tools available to help improve your writing. Utilizing these tools is essential for ensuring the accuracy and quality of your work. One important aspect is the ability to catch and correct grammar and spelling errors, which can greatly enhance the overall clarity of your writing. These tools also provide suggestions for improving sentence structure and word choice, helping you create more concise and effective sentences.

However, it’s important to consider the pros and cons of automated proofreading tools. On one hand, they offer convenience and speed, allowing you to quickly identify errors in your writing. They can also help with consistency by highlighting inconsistencies in formatting or style. On the other hand, automated tools may not always understand context or accurately interpret meaning, leading to incorrect suggestions or overlooking certain errors.

Ultimately, using proofreading tools can significantly improve the quality of your writing, but it’s important to carefully review their suggestions and make informed decisions based on your own understanding of language and style.

Key Features to Look for in Proofreading Tools

When choosing a proofreading tool, you should look for key features that meet your specific needs. There are many common misconceptions about proofreading tools, but the truth is that they have evolved significantly over the years and offer advanced functionalities.

As we look towards the future of proofreading technology, it’s important to consider the following key features:

  • Advanced grammar and spelling checkers
  • Plagiarism detection capabilities
  • Style and tone suggestions
  • Customizable settings for personalized preferences
  • Integration with various platforms and software

These features ensure that you have control over your writing while receiving accurate and thorough feedback. By incorporating these advancements into their tools, developers are shaping the future of proofreading technology.

How to Choose the Right Proofreading Tool for You

To choose the right proofreading tool for you, it’s important to consider your specific needs and preferences.

Automated proofreading tools have their pros and cons. One of the biggest advantages is their speed and efficiency in detecting errors and suggesting corrections. They can save you time and help improve the overall quality of your writing. However, they may not catch all mistakes or understand contextual nuances, which means some errors might slip through the cracks.

When comparing free and paid proofreading software, it’s essential to weigh the features offered against your requirements. Free options usually come with limited functionality, while paid versions offer more advanced features like plagiarism detection or integration with other writing tools.

Ultimately, it’s crucial to find a proofreading tool that aligns with your specific needs and preferences to achieve accurate and polished writing results.

Tips for Maximizing the Benefits of Proofreading Tools

One way to get the most out of proofreading tools is by familiarizing yourself with their features and settings. These tips will help you improve your proofreading skills while also understanding the limitations of these tools:

  • Take advantage of grammar and spelling suggestions, but remember that they are not always accurate. Use your own judgment when accepting or rejecting suggestions.
  • Utilize the style and readability checkers to ensure your writing is clear and concise.
  • Pay attention to punctuation errors, as these can greatly impact the clarity of your message.
  • Use the plagiarism checker to avoid unintentional plagiarism and ensure originality in your work.
  • Proofread manually after using the tool to catch any errors that may have been missed.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Using Proofreading Tools

Make sure you are aware of common mistakes to avoid while using proofreading tools. While these tools can be incredibly helpful in catching errors and improving the quality of your writing, there are a few misconceptions that people often have about them.

One common misconception is that proofreading tools can replace human proofreaders entirely. However, this is not the case. Proofreading tools are powerful aids, but they should be used in conjunction with human proofreaders who can provide a deeper level of analysis and understanding.

Another mistake to avoid is relying too heavily on the suggestions provided by the tool without critically evaluating them yourself. Remember, these tools are not infallible and may sometimes make incorrect suggestions. Therefore, it’s important to use your own judgment and expertise when making changes to your writing based on their recommendations.
